  • Page 20: Cold Water Supply

    Pressure reducing valve The pressure reducing valve can be connected anywhere on the cold water mains supply prior to the Remeha Flexistor unit. There is no requirement to site it close to the unit, it can be located at a point where the mains supply enters the premises if this is more convenient but you must install a non-return valve just after the reducing valve for ease of maintenance.

  • Page 51 Warranty Terms Remeha guarantees the water heater cylinder against faulty manufacture or materials for a period of two years from the date of purchase including parts and labour. This two year guarantee is extended to five years for the cold water control valve and to 25 years (from the date of installation) for the stainless steel inner vessel.
